Responsibilities
- Conduct user research to support new policies, identify unmet needs, and test improvements, including reviewing previous research on supplier payment services.
- Create a user research plan with key goals, methods, and participant criteria, ensuring thorough documentation and communication of findings.
- Recruit a diverse range of participants, including those with accessibility needs, maintaining a research schedule of every three weeks.
- Collaborate with design and development teams to design, test, and refine prototypes, prioritising research to meet policy implementation targets.
- Work with stakeholders to prioritise and design service improvements based on user insights, ensuring alignment with DDaT and GOV.UK standards.
- Continuously test and refine enhancements, validating user needs across segments with design and development teams.

What you need to know about the Belfast Tech Scene
If asked to name the birthplace of the RMS Titanic, you might not say Belfast. Similarly, if asked to name Europe's leading destination for foreign direct investment in new software development, Belfast might not come to mind. Yet, both are true. The city has emerged as a tech powerhouse, recently ranked among the best in the U.K. for tech careers — especially for software developers. It also leads the U.K. with the highest percentage of software development jobs advertised.
